Martyrs and Injuries in Ongoing Israeli Airstrikes on Gaza Strip
SadaNews - Several citizens were martyred and injured on Friday due to ongoing Israeli airstrikes on the Gaza Strip.
It was announced that 3 citizens were martyred, including the journalist Adam Abu Harbeid, when occupation planes targeted a tent in Yarmouk Market, which shelters displaced people in the Al-Daraj neighborhood in the center of Gaza City.
In addition, several others were martyred and injured due to the bombing of a tent for displaced people on the rooftop of the Al-Rimal Preparatory School on Mustafa Habib Street in Gaza City.
Meanwhile, one citizen was martyred as a result of the bombing of a tent housing displaced people in the vicinity of the slaughterhouse area west of Khan Younis in the southern Gaza Strip.
Several areas, especially east of Gaza City and Khan Younis, witnessed continuous air and artillery bombardments and demolition operations.
